HOOSIERS WIN OPENER AT BIG TEN TOURNAMENT
4/9/1999 12:00:00 AM | Women's Water Polo
Simone breaks single-season steal mark
East Lansing, Mich.--The Indiana Women's Water Polo team routed Purdue 14-1 during the opening day of the Big Ten Women's Water Polo Tournament.
Sophomore driver Deb Simone scored twice, dished out three assists and had a steal as five Indiana players scored two goals a piece. With her 100th steal of the season, Simone broke the IU single-season steal mark of 99 set last year by Kara Fellerhoff.
Sheri Fagley, Kara Fellerhoff, Kristin Carpenter and Molly Fonner were the other Hoosiers with two goals tonight. IU is 16-1 over the last two years when Carpenter scores two or more goals and Fonner notched her sixth multiple goal game of the year.
Indiana (14-12) also received the first goals of the year from Suzanne Rose and Erin Rice as nine different Hoosiers found the back of the net.
In tomorrow's action, the second-seeded Hoosiers take on sixth-seeded Illinois at 12:20 p.m (EDT) and third-seeded Michigan State at 3:35 p.m.(EDT). If the Hoosiers win their bracket, they will play at 9:05 p.m.(EDT) against the second place team in Bracket A. If Indiana takes second, it will play at 8:05 p.m.(EDT), against the Bracket A winner.
